Values
HEX #A96A81
RGB rgb(169, 106, 129)
HSL hsl(338°, 27%, 54%)
CMYK C:0% M:37% Y:24% K:34%
Luminance 0.2058
WCAG Accessibility
On white 4.15:1
Aa — #A96A81
Secondary text
✗ AA ✗ AAA ✓ AA Large
On black 5.07:1
Aa — #A96A81
Secondary text
✓ AA ✗ AAA ✓ AA Large
